Hydrophobicity of Polyacrylate Emulsion Film Enhanced by Introduction of Nano-SiO(2) and Fluorine
This study proposes to utilize modified Nano-SiO(2)/fluorinated polyacrylate emulsion that was synthesized with a semi-continuous starved seed emulsion polymerization to improve the hydrophobicity, thermal stability, and UV-Vis absorption of polyacrylate emulsion film.
